Belltown is a neighborhood in Jurupa Valley, California. It is located within Riverside County. This area sits about 840 feet (256 meters) above sea level.

How Belltown Got Its Name
Belltown was not always called Belltown. It was first known as West Riverside. However, the people living there wanted their community to have its own special identity. They wanted to be different from the larger city of Riverside that was nearby. So, they decided to vote and change the name. That's how West Riverside became Belltown!
Belltown's Journey to Becoming a City
For many years, Belltown was an unincorporated community. This means it was not officially part of any city. Instead, it was directly governed by Riverside County. But things changed on July 1, 2011. On that day, Belltown officially became a part of the newly formed city of Jurupa Valley. This was a big step for the community.
Where is Belltown Located?
Belltown is located on the west side of the Santa Ana River. It sits right across the river from the city of Riverside. This location makes it an important part of the region.
Who Founded Belltown?
Belltown was founded in the year 1907. The person who started this community was N.G. Bell.
